嵌入式实时操作系统VxWorks及其开发环境Tornado

嵌入式实时操作系统VxWorks及其开发环境Tornado
作 者: 孔祥营 柏桂枝
出版社: 中国电力出版社
丛编项:
版权说明: 本书为公共版权或经版权方授权,请支持正版图书
标 签: 嵌入式计算机
ISBN 出版时间 包装 开本 页数 字数
未知 暂无 暂无 未知 0 暂无

作者简介

暂缺《嵌入式实时操作系统VxWorks及其开发环境Tornado》作者简介

内容简介

编辑推荐:本书主要介绍了嵌入式开发的基本概念、Tornado II开发环境的使用和VxWorks操作系统程序设计核心技术等内容。作者为国内VxWorks首批用户,多年来一直从事嵌入式实时系统的开发与设计,本书根据有关文献,结合作者工程开发经验编写而成,有很强的实用和参考价值。 本书适合嵌入式系统开发人员阅读,也可供其他爱好者参考。

图书目录

前言

第1章 嵌入式实时系统软件设计

1. 1 嵌入式实时系统

1. 2 嵌入式实时系统软件开发设计

1. 3 嵌入式实时操作系统

1. 4 如何选择实时操作系统

1. 5 本书的组织

第2章 VxWorks操作系统与实时应用

2. 1 实时应用的基本需求

2. 2 VxWorks简介

2. 3 Tornado集成开发环境简介

第3章 Tornado使用初步

3. 1 TornadoII的新特征

3. 2 TornadoII安装

3. 3 Tornado简单教程

3. 4 Tornado1. 0. 1下的工程开发

第4章 VxWorks任务与任务编程接口

4. 1 VxWorks任务

4. 2 VxWorks任务编程接口

4. 3 POSIX调度接口

第5章 任务间通信

5. 1 VxWorks任务间通信机制

5. 2 共享数据结构

5, 3 互斥

5. 4 信号量

5. 5 消息队列

5. 6 管道

第6章 信号. 中断处理与定时机制

6. 1 信号(Signals)

6. 2 中断服务程序

6. 3 看门狗

6. 4 POSIX时钟和计时器

6. 5 POSIX内存上锁接口

第7章 建立调试环境与实例分析

7. 1 建立调试环境

7. 2 实例分析

第8章 网络编程

8. 1 VxWorks网络组件

8. 2 TCP/IP协议

8. 3 套接字基础

8. 4 Socket编程接口

8. 5 Socket的原始方式

第9章 客户/服务器编程

9. 1 客户/服务器

9. 2 客户端程序设计

9. 3 服务器端程序设计

9. 4 服务端程序结构

9. 5 多协议(TCP. UDP)服务端

9. 6 编程实例

第10章 VxWorks操作系统配置

10. 1 VxWorks的目录与文件

10. 2 VxWorks的板级支持包BSP

10. 3 VxWorks的配置文件与配置项

10. 4 VxWorks的初始化

10. 5 可选的VxWorks配置

第11章 编程实战

11. 1 程序执行时间

11. 2 多任务

11. 3 信号量

11. 4 消息队列

11. 5 轮转调度算法

11. 6 基于优先级的抢占式调度

11. 7 优先级转置

11. 8 信号

11. 9 中断服务程序

附录 参考文献